Cloud services have completely changed how modern gaming applications are built, delivered, and experienced. From multiplayer mobile games to large-scale online platforms, cloud technology provides the backbone that keeps games running smoothly.
In today’s digital ecosystem, even platforms like bandar slot style online gaming environments rely heavily on cloud infrastructure to handle traffic, user data, and real-time gameplay. Without cloud computing, these systems would struggle with performance, scalability, and reliability.
This article explains how cloud services support gaming applications in simple terms, focusing on performance, scalability, security, and user experience.
Understanding Cloud Services in Gaming
Cloud services refer to computing resources (servers, storage, databases, networking, software) delivered over the internet instead of local hardware.
In gaming, cloud systems handle:
- Game hosting
- Player data storage
- Matchmaking systems
- Real-time multiplayer communication
- Updates and patches
Instead of relying on a single physical server, cloud gaming systems use distributed networks across multiple regions.
This ensures that players experience smooth gameplay regardless of where they are located.
Why Gaming Applications Need Cloud Support
Modern games are no longer simple offline programs. They require constant updates, live interactions, and global connectivity.
Here’s why cloud support is essential:
1. Global Player Access
Games today attract millions of users worldwide. Cloud systems allow players from different regions to connect without lag or interruptions.
2. Real-Time Interaction
Multiplayer games depend on instant communication between players. Cloud servers reduce latency and improve synchronization.
3. Continuous Updates
Developers can push updates instantly without requiring users to reinstall the game.
4. Scalability
When a game becomes popular overnight, cloud systems can automatically expand resources.
Even fast-growing platforms like bandar slot style gaming environments depend on scalable cloud architecture to manage sudden traffic spikes.
Core Cloud Models Used in Gaming
Gaming applications typically use three main types of cloud computing models:
Infrastructure as a Service (IaaS)
This provides virtual servers, storage, and networking.
Game developers use IaaS to:
- Host game servers
- Store large game files
- Manage backend systems
Platform as a Service (PaaS)
This offers a development environment for building games.
It helps developers:
- Build and test games faster
- Deploy updates easily
- Focus on gameplay instead of infrastructure
Software as a Service (SaaS)
This delivers ready-to-use gaming services.
Examples include:
- Cloud gaming platforms
- Leaderboards
- Multiplayer matchmaking systems
How Cloud Services Improve Game Performance
Performance is one of the most important aspects of gaming. Cloud computing improves performance in several ways:
Reduced Latency
Cloud servers placed closer to users reduce the time it takes for data to travel.
Load Balancing
Traffic is distributed across multiple servers to prevent overload.
Edge Computing
Processing happens near the user instead of a central server, making gameplay smoother.
Faster Data Processing
Cloud systems use high-performance computing resources that local devices cannot match.
Cloud Scalability in Gaming Applications
Scalability means the system can grow or shrink based on demand.
How It Works
If a game suddenly gains millions of players:
- Cloud servers automatically expand
- Extra computing power is allocated
- Performance remains stable
If activity drops:
- Resources are reduced
- Costs are optimized
This flexibility is crucial for online gaming platforms, including casino-style ecosystems like bandar slot, where user activity can fluctuate rapidly.
Cloud Storage for Gaming Data
Games generate massive amounts of data:
- Player profiles
- Game progress
- Achievements
- In-game purchases
Cloud storage ensures:
Data Safety
Even if a device is lost, data remains secure online.
Easy Access
Players can continue their progress from any device.
Backup Systems
Automatic backups prevent data loss.
Multiplayer Gaming and Cloud Infrastructure
Multiplayer gaming is one of the biggest beneficiaries of cloud services.
Matchmaking Systems
Cloud servers quickly match players based on:
- Skill level
- Region
- Game mode
Real-Time Communication
Cloud networks support instant data exchange between players.
Server Synchronization
All players see the same game state at the same time.
Without cloud infrastructure, real-time multiplayer games would experience delays and disconnects.
Cloud Security in Gaming Applications
Security is a major concern in online gaming.
Cloud services protect games through:
Data Encryption
Sensitive data is encrypted during transfer and storage.
DDoS Protection
Cloud systems prevent attacks that try to crash game servers.
Authentication Systems
Players must verify identity before accessing accounts.
Fraud Detection
Unusual activity patterns are flagged automatically.
This is especially important in competitive online environments, including platforms like bandar slot style systems, where secure transactions and fair play are essential.
Cloud and Game Updates
Traditionally, updating games required manual downloads. Now, cloud systems make updates seamless.
Benefits of Cloud-Based Updates
- Instant patch deployment
- No large downloads for users
- Bug fixes applied in real time
- New content added frequently
Developers can improve games continuously without interrupting gameplay.
Cloud Gaming (Streaming-Based Gaming)
Cloud gaming allows players to stream games instead of installing them.
How It Works
- Game runs on a cloud server
- Video output is streamed to the user
- User inputs are sent back to the server
Advantages
- No need for high-end devices
- Instant access to games
- Cross-platform compatibility
Challenges
- Requires strong internet connection
- Latency issues in some regions
Artificial Intelligence and Cloud in Gaming
Cloud systems also power AI in games.
AI Uses in Gaming
- Smart NPC behavior
- Personalized recommendations
- Adaptive difficulty levels
- Fraud detection systems
Cloud computing provides the processing power needed for advanced AI systems.
Cost Efficiency for Game Developers
Cloud computing reduces development costs.
Traditional Hosting vs Cloud
Traditional:
- Expensive servers
- Maintenance costs
- Limited flexibility
Cloud:
- Pay-as-you-go model
- No physical hardware required
- Easy scaling
This allows even small studios to create large-scale games.
Cloud Monitoring and Analytics
Cloud systems provide real-time analytics:
- Player activity tracking
- Server performance monitoring
- Revenue insights
- Gameplay behavior analysis
Developers use this data to improve user experience and fix issues quickly.
Challenges of Cloud in Gaming
Despite its benefits, cloud gaming also has challenges:
Internet Dependency
Without stable internet, performance suffers.
Latency Issues
Distance from servers can affect response time.
Data Privacy Concerns
User data must be carefully protected.
High Bandwidth Usage
Cloud gaming consumes significant data.
Future of Cloud Gaming
The future of gaming is deeply connected to cloud technology.
We can expect:
- Fully cloud-based AAA games
- Improved global server networks
- AI-powered game worlds
- Seamless cross-device gaming
- Reduced hardware dependency
Even gaming ecosystems similar to bandar slot platforms will likely evolve using more advanced cloud systems for better speed and reliability.
Real-World Example of Cloud Gaming Architecture
A typical cloud gaming system includes:
- Front-end user interface
- Game servers in multiple regions
- Database servers for player data
- Load balancers for traffic management
- Content delivery networks (CDNs)
This layered structure ensures smooth performance even under heavy load.
Conclusion
Cloud services are the foundation of modern gaming applications. They provide scalability, performance, security, and global accessibility that traditional systems cannot match.
From multiplayer experiences to cloud gaming platforms, everything depends on distributed computing power. Developers can now create complex, immersive worlds that run smoothly for millions of players at the same time.
As technology continues to evolve, cloud systems will become even more advanced, enabling faster, smarter, and more interactive gaming experiences for users around the world.
Whether it’s large-scale multiplayer games, mobile apps, or online ecosystems like bandar slot, cloud computing ensures that gaming remains fast, secure, and accessible for everyone.